Read moreIf you are looking for a laid-back place for a coffee break or a healthy start into the day, you should stop by at Nourish‘d. The menu is fresh, healthy, and completely plant-based. Since I am a breakfast person I was happy to find so many options on the menu — bowls, toasts, smoothies. If you are craving for a vitamin kick there are many of freshly made juices that come in gorgeous glass bottles. I loved my warm oaties, and the banana toast with almond butter was luscious too. It’s lovely to sit outside on the tiny patio under the palm roof — but you have to be lucky to find a free spot there since the store at Kloof street was right away super busy when we arrived there in the early morning. It’s really a vibrant place full of young people. If you are staying in the area of Woodstock or Observatory I would recommend to visit the second store in OBS instead, since this one is way more spacious and less crowded. We visited that store for another juice break in the afternoon and it was quite empty. So that’s your chance to escape the hustle and bustle from the city while second hand shopping in OBS. I am sure that this boho area will become way more busy and trendy in the next years, so go there before the tourist masses will do so too.
